Hi, looking for an injector good for 700hp on e85. Looking for feedback on guys using the bigger fic bluemax injectors. How did it idle? Did you use an injector driver?

I'm considering the 1850cc fic bluemax injectors with a fjo driver and e85.

Any insight? I really want to keep it simple instead of using (8) 1000cc injectors.

The fjo driver is a very reliable and afordable piece. Way less complaints than the aem driver. There is an e85 station about 45min from me, there's only 3 in Ontario, and Ontario is fairly large. The other station is about 1hr and it's right on the way to one of the local tracks I race at.

No one up here runs e85, but I don't daily drive the car and when you compare the bit of a drive it takes to buy it vs the cost of race fuel which I can't get local anyways it's very much worth it.

I do believe I will be going with the fic 1850s and the fjo driver. With the driver and e85 it will be like getting a car on gas to idle with a stock resistor pack and 1200s which is still do able.
